Jon C. W. Pevehouse

Jon C. W. Pevehouse

Dr. Jon C.W. Pevehouse is Professor of Political Science at the University of Wisconsin-Madison. He is an award-winning scholar and teacher. Jon's research interests focus on foreign policy, international political economy, and international organizations. He is currently the editor of the leading professional journal in the field, International Organization. Professor Pevehouse received his BA from the University of Kansas and his PhD from Ohio State University.

Joshua S. Goldstein

Joshua S. Goldstein

Dr. Joshua S. Goldstein is an award winning Professor Emeritus of International Relations, American University (Washington, DC) and Research Scholar, University of Massachusetts-Amherst. He is a well known scholar who has spoken and written widely on war and society, including war's effects on gender, psychological trauma and economics.). Joshua's book War and Gender won the International Studies Association's "Book of the Decade" award.

International Relations, 3rd Canadian Edition, (PDF) presents the current concepts, theories, and events that include the discipline in a comprehensive yet accessible manner. Each of these elements is examined through the subfields of international security; law, international organization, political economy; North-South issues; and the environment.

This text shows how the various subfields of international relations are incorporated conceptually while the use of concrete examples relates theory back to the real world events present in students’ lives.

The IR 3rd Canadian Edition deepens the Canadian perspective; includes new coverage of the latest major international events; and places more stress on the Environment, International Law, and International Organizations.
